WebCreate custom actions rules in Outlook for Windows Click the File tab. In the right pane, click Manage Rules & Alerts. In the Rules and Alerts box, on the Email Rules tab, click New Rule. Under Start from a blank rule, click either Apply rule on messages I receive or Apply rule on messages I send, ... WebCreate a rule from a template Select File > Manage Rules & Alerts > New Rule. Select a template. For example, to flag a message: Select Flag messages from someone for follow-up. Edit the rule description. Select an underlined value, choose the options you want, and then select OK. Select Next.
